Program Information
Corwin Ford of Nampa offers a full-time Auto Technician Apprenticeship designed to prepare individuals for long-term careers in automotive service and repair within a high-volume dealership environment. This employer-sponsored apprenticeship provides paid, hands-on training under the guidance of experienced technicians while allowing apprentices to earn competitive wages as they build technical skills. The program is ideal for entry-level candidates or early-career technicians looking to advance within a structured dealership setting.
Apprentices work directly in Corwin Ford’s service department, assisting with vehicle diagnostics, maintenance, and repair while learning manufacturer-recommended procedures and best practices. Training focuses on developing real-world service skills, including inspections, oil changes, fluid replacement, tire services, and basic diagnostics. Apprentices gain exposure to modern vehicle systems and dealership workflows, helping them build a strong technical foundation.
A key feature of this apprenticeship is Corwin Ford’s investment in technician development. Apprentices receive continuous, paid training and mentorship, along with access to tool allocation to support skill growth. The dealership emphasizes safety, organization, and professionalism, preparing apprentices for long-term success and advancement within the Corwin Auto Group.
This apprenticeship is structured as a career pathway rather than a temporary role. Apprentices who demonstrate commitment and technical progress may advance into higher-level technician roles, with opportunities for continued certification, specialization, and potential movement into leadership or management positions over time.
Program Length
- Ongoing, employer-sponsored apprenticeship
- Length depends on skill progression and career advancement
- Full-time schedule with guaranteed 40+ hours per week
Hands-On Training
Apprentices gain practical experience in:
- Vehicle inspections and preventative maintenance
- Oil changes, tire rotations, and fluid replacement
- Basic automotive diagnostics and repair assistance
- Use of dealership tools and service equipment
- Maintaining a clean, safe, and organized work environment
Program Requirements
- High School Diploma or GED preferred
- Valid driver’s license and clean driving record
- Interest in automotive repair and service careers
- Basic mechanical knowledge or hands-on experience is a plus
- Ability to lift up to 50 pounds and stand for extended periods
Wages & Benefits
- Hourly pay range of approximately $18–$22 based on experience
- Paid, continuous on-the-job training
- Health, dental, vision, and life insurance
- 401(k) retirement plan with company match
- Paid vacation and sick time
- Tool allocation provided
- Employee discounts and vehicle purchase plans
- Clear advancement opportunities within the dealership

Apprenticeship Cost & Career Outlook
Auto Technician Apprenticeship – Corwin Ford of Nampa is a Registered Apprenticeship Program — meaning you can earn while you learn through paid on-the-job training in Automotive.
- Paid on-the-job training with step increases as you progress
- Classroom / technical instruction is part of the program structure
- Training costs are often low — but you may still pay for tools, books, or fees
- Credential earned at completion is recognized by employers in the industry
Registered apprenticeships are overseen by the U.S. Department of Labor or a State Apprenticeship Agency. Because these programs aren’t traditional colleges, College Scorecard tuition and earnings data usually doesn’t apply.
